How To Listen To PBS

PBS News
Thu 14 Apr 2022

edm-mrec_a_pbs_thesaturdaypaper_2022.jpg

PBS The Specialist Music Station
With more and more ways to listen to PBS, we are here to give you all the options.

Free to air Radio - in your car, in your home, at a picnic!

You can find us on free to air radio broadcast on 106.7FM and DAB+ in Melbourne, Australia.

Streaming

You can also listen live through our website by pressing the play button at the top of each page. If you'd like to listen to a previous program, head to the program page you desire, select the date you want and press play.

We have a PBS app, that is available free to download from either the Apple app store, or Google Play. You can stream live or listen On Demand through our app.

For those of you who like using other apps, we are on iHeartRadio, TuneIn, and Beetroot. We are also picked up by many other streaming apps, some of which we don't even know about! If you suddenly stop being able to get PBS on any app, please contact the app directly and let them know. You can also let us know, and we will do our best to reach out to them too. If you have a particularly involved sound system that is asking for a direct streaming URL please use: https://playerservices.streamtheworld.com/api/livestream-redirect/3PBS_F... 

HLS: https://playerservices.streamtheworld.com/api/livestream-redirect/3PBS_F...

Shoutcast: https://playerservices.streamtheworld.com/api/livestream-redirect/3PBS_F...

Format info:

SD livestream: 48kHz, 64kbps HE-AAC

HD livestream: 48kHz, 128kbps HE-AAC

Radio on Demand: 44.1kHz, 128kHz CBR MP3

Contact us if you have any questions.

Even though we are a community radio station with limited resources, we are always working to improve our streaming process. At the moment we are working on being more compatible with smart speakers and casting. If you come across a fault, feel free to let us know, and we can try to fix it.
